About Lohamalia Village

Lohamalia is a mid sized village in Jamboni tehsil, in the district of Paschim Medinipur, West Bengal.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 541, made up of 264 males and 277 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,049 females per 1000 males. The village covers 89.29 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 721503,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Lohamalia

The census records public bus service for Lohamalia as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
